I still remember the original that started it all on Starcraft. It was called Aeon of Strife and was one sided. All players fought on the "losing" side and had to build up and defend the lanes. It got harder as time went on so basically you had about an hour time limit before the enemy just swamped you with elite units. It was well designed for the most part. The main flaw seemed to be that it was very hard and basically could only be won using the zergling as hero unit. What I miss about it that is not in Dota was the large numbers of enemies to kill each spawn time. Dota only has about 5-6 per spawn and slow respawns.
